A zero energy transport apartment complex is a building that utilizes energy efficiency and renewable energy to produce as much energy as it consumes over the course of a year. By harnessing solar, wind, or geothermal energy, these structures minimize their reliance on non-renewable energy sources and reduce greenhouse gas emissions. The goal of a zero energy transport apartment complex is to create a self-sustaining ecosystem that not only preserves resources for future generations but also enhances the overall quality of life for its occupants.
Design Approaches for a Zero Energy Transport Apartment Complex
- Renewable Energy Systems: Solar panels, wind turbines, or geothermal systems are integrated into the building design to generate clean energy and power the structure.
- Energy-Efficient Insulation: Advanced insulation materials and air-tight construction techniques are used to minimize heat transfer and reduce energy losses.
- Smart Lighting and HVAC Systems: Automated lighting and he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ems optimize energy consumption and promote indoor air quality.
- Recycling and Waste Management: Strategies for recycling and waste reduction are integrated into the building's design to minimize its environmental impact.
- Green Roofs and Urban Planning: Vegetated roofs and rooftop gardens not only provide insulation and reduce stormwater runoff but also create habitats for local wildlife.

Benefits of a Zero Energy Transport Apartment Complex
The benefits of a zero energy transport apartment complex extend beyond environmental sustainability, encompassing several aspects of a resident's life.
- Energy Savings: By harnessing renewable energy sources, residents can reduce their utility bills and enjoy significant energy savings.
- Improved Indoor Air Quality: Advanced ventilation and air filtration systems create a healthier living space, reducing the risk of respiratory illnesses.
- Enhanced Comfort: Energy-efficient insulation and climate control systems ensure a consistent and comfortable indoor climate, year-round.
- Increased Property Value: A zero energy transport apartment complex can increase property values, providing a competitive edge in the rental or resale market.
- Community Building: Sustainable living spaces foster a sense of community, promoting social connections and collaboration among residents.
